Monterrey's air quality reflects the Monterrey metropolitan area's severe topographic enclosure in the Sierra Madre Oriental mountain basin at 537 metres, with vehicle traffic on the Periférico Ecológico and the surrounding steel, glass, cement, and manufacturing corridor — Monterrey being Mexico's industrial capital — generating elevated industrial PM2.5 and SO₂. The surrounding mountain walls create complete topographic enclosure, while the Cerro de la Silla and Cerro de las Mitras create dramatic topography and Monterrey maintains among Mexico's more industrially challenging urban environments throughout the year.

When is air pollution at its worst in Monterrey?

The biggest local contributors to pollution in Monterrey are road traffic, heavy industry such as steel, cement, or petrochemical processing, as well as manufacturing and food processing, particularly once dry, windy weather picks up. Dust carried on these winds adds substantially to particulate levels. This is most noticeable during spring and autumn wind events.

Are air quality levels in Monterrey based on measurements or forecasts?

It is forecasts derived by downscaling forecasts provided by EU’s Copernicus Atmosphere Monitoring Service (CAMS) by taking into account local conditions such as traffic patterns. CAMS bases its forecast on satellite measurements of particles and chemical compounds in the atmosphere. Why doesn’t the forecast always reflect wildfire impacts?

Airmine’s forecast uses CAMS (Copernicus Atmosphere Monitoring Service) as its background atmospheric model. While CAMS includes wildfire emissions, these are derived from satellite observations and are not available in real time. During rapidly evolving wildfire events, there may therefore be a delay before increased emissions are incorporated into the model. As a result, the forecast may temporarily underestimate PM₂.₅ and other pollutants associated with wildfire smoke.

During rapidly evolving wildfire events, CAMS may lag by approximately 1–2 days before increased wildfire emissions are fully represented, which can lead to temporary underestimation of PM₂.₅ concentrations in Airmine’s forecast.
